Ford Motor Company to Participate in Jefferies Disrupt Summit: Techonomy 2020

On Monday, Oct. 22, Dr. Ken Washington, Ford’s vice president of Research and Advanced Engineering and Chief Technology Officer, will participate in the 2018 Jefferies Disrupt Summit: Techonomy 2020 in New York. The event explores how leaders across diverse industries are rewriting old business models and creating new innovation ecosystems.

Washington’s panel discussion on disruption within mobility will begin at 1:30 p.m. ET followed by a question-and-answer session.

About Ford Motor Company

Ford Motor Company is a global company based in Dearborn, Michigan. The company designs, manufactures, markets and services a full line of Ford cars, trucks, SUVs, electrified vehicles and Lincoln luxury vehicles, provides financial services through Ford Motor Credit Company and is pursuing leadership positions in electrification, autonomous vehicles and mobility solutions. Ford employs approximately 201,000 people worldwide. For more information regarding Ford, its products and Ford Motor Credit Company, please visit www.corporate.ford.com.
